高亮显示 Java代码 public SolrDocumentList query(String str) { SolrQuery ...
高亮显示 Java代码 public SolrDocumentList query(String str) { SolrQuery ...
与用户查询的匹配程度来决定。为查询结果选择最佳片段进行显示,这是Solr高亮框架提供的核心功能。 二. ...
Solr高亮 原理 做搜索时,高亮是很常见的需求,那么Solr肯定也为高亮提供了支持。先解释下Solr高亮的原理,在我们设置了需要高亮显示的Field之后,查询得到的返回结果会多出来下面的内容: 其实就是多了highlighting的字段,并没有改变原来返回的字段 ...
官网:https://lucene.apache.org/solr/guide/6_6/highlighting.html#Highlighting-TheUnifiedHighlighter 前言 solr的高亮允许匹配用户查询的文档的片段包含在查询响应中返回 ...
1.查询(Querying Data) --q 文档 fl 表示相应的属性 1) 内容: 搜索过程是通过带q参数的GET HTTP请求select URL.同 ...
查询时的api分为两种一种是万能的set,还有一种是setxxxquery 可以看到查询时用的set(xxx)与solrAdmin页面的查询界面想对应 关于高亮: 1.首先高亮的域必须出现在查询条件中,如果你设置了返回域,请把要高亮的域对象包含其中 2.高亮 ...
Solr主要是为了做搜索引擎,前台传来的数据,我们通过在solr中设置对应的域,来对solr库中的对应的字段进行中文分词检索,来返回map,前台获取。 代码展示: 前台传来一个map集合,带着所有关键字到后台获取列表集合 ...
Solr分页与高亮(使用SolrNet实现) 本节我们使用Asp.net MVC实现Solr客户端查询,建议使用SolrNet这个客户端,开源地址在:https://github.com/mausch/SolrNet 推荐的理由主要有: 1. 高效的反序列化操作; 2. 社区活跃,用户众多 ...